Red Hat EL 4 can not detect Disk Array on ML110 g3

Hello everyone,
Please help me, here is my problem:

I have a ML110 g3 Server with 2 80 Gb SATA disks, I created a RAID 0 Array the array is visible by BIOS and when the system is comming up, it shows 1 logical unit found, when I try to install Red Hat Enterprise Linux 4, I get the message "An error has ocurred - no valid devices were found on wich to create a new file system. Please check your hardware for the cause of this problem.
I downloaded the HP Embedded SATA RAID Controller Driver Diskette for Red Hat Enterprise Linux 4 (x86) and installed with #linux update dd, I get the same message.
Does anyone know How can I solve it?
